Ponca State Park features fun activities for all ages

LINCOLN, Neb. – Ease into July with a series of fun summer activities for all ages at Ponca State Park.

June 27 – Take an introductory course to archery and muzzleloading, and learn how to make a bird feeder from everyday items in the home.

June 28 – Learn how to shoot a pellet rifle, discover the types of wildflowers growing in the park, and find out about a giant creature that swam through the park 90 million years ago.

June 29 – More archery is available, plus activities about the power of the sun and how birds communicate with each other.

June 30-July 1 – Backwater kayaking, parachute races and kite flying are scheduled both days. An introductory course to archery and shotguns, crafts and critter programs are scheduled June 30 and a course tomahawk and atlatl throwing, as well as a scavenger hunt hike, will take place July 1.

Visit the park’s Facebook page or call 402-755-2284 for more information. A permit is required of each vehicle entering the park.
